GRANT AIDS RIOT RIDDEN S.C. BUSINESSES 06-17-10 20:20 a.v.

While investigations continue into the Santa Cruz May-Day riots, a city grant program is helping business owners replace damaged storefronts.   The funds stem from the Façade Improvement Program, an economic-development initiative launched 16-years ago to update ageing storefronts. The program provides up to $10,000 per project, will match up to another $5,000 in redevelopment money and can not go towards maintenance work.   The proposed work needs to meet city approval.  Businesses must be in the downtown area, have at least 3 years remaining on their lease and a building cant have received a grant in the past 10-years.
